Sec. 80.9  Rounding a test result for determining conformance with a fuels standard.

    (a) For purposes of determining compliance with the fuel standards 
of 40 CFR part 80, a test result will be rounded to the nearest unit of 
significant digits specified in the applicable fuel standard in 
accordance with the rounding method described in the ASTM standard 
practice, ASTM E 29-02[isin]1, entitled, ``Standard Practice 
for Using Significant Digits in Test Data to Determine Conformance with 
Specifications''.
